OVERVIEW
Mostar stands beside the Neretva River in southern Bosnia and Herzegovina, with a restored stone bridge linking historic neighbourhoods on steep banks. Ottoman architecture and later districts reflect a complex multicultural past. PRACTICAL INFORMATION
Languages
Croatian · Bosnian
Currency
Bosnia-Herzegovina convertible mark · BAM
Payments
Cards accepted
Tipping
5–10% customary
Time zone
UTC+1 · UTC+2
Tap water
Safe to drink
Plug type
Type C / F · 230 V · 50 Hz
Emergency
Police 122 · Ambulance 124 · Fire 123
